1. Assess the Value of Your Home
A successful sale starts with proper pricing. Research comparable home sales in Gastonia to gauge market trends, or hire a professional appraiser to obtain an accurate valuation. Pricing too high might deter buyers, while pricing too low could leave money on the table.
2. Prepare Your Home for Sale
First impressions matter. Enhance your home’s curb appeal by cleaning, decluttering, and performing minor repairs. If you’re selling as-is, you can skip costly updates by working with cash home buyers who purchase homes in any condition.
3. Market Your Property Effectively
When listing traditionally, use quality photos, videos, and detailed descriptions to attract interest. Highlight your home’s unique features. Alternatively, you can avoid marketing costs altogether by selling directly to a trusted cash buyer.
4. Review Offers Strategically
Once you start receiving offers, consider more than just price. Look at contingencies, timelines, and buyer qualifications. Cash offers can often simplify the process by eliminating financing delays or inspection hurdles.
5. Close the Sale
During closing, all parties finalize agreements, and ownership is officially transferred. Selling to a cash buyer can accelerate this process, allowing you to close in as little as 7 days.
